Performance Testing simulates real-world load spikes. Using Apache JMeter scripts, we test how many concurrent users your web application can support. This isolates sluggish server APIs or database query limits so your system doesn't crash on product launches.
Functional Testing uses automated scripts to check key paths (like payments or checkout). We code Selenium Java suites that run automatically during CI/CD updates. This ensures code changes never break user experiences.
SEO is a progressive strategy. While structural edits show crawl fixes in weeks, competitive keyword ranking hikes and local Google Map pack visibility increases typically require 3 to 6 months of active content indexing.
